Back suspended for four weeks

 
 

20 May 2005
Neil Back was handed a four-week ban for striking an opponent at an RFU disciplinary hearing on Thursday night.

The Leicester flanker was charged after the Premiership Citing Officer reviewed video footage of the Zurich Premiership Final between Leicester and London Wasps at Twickenham on May 14.

Back pleaded guilty to the charge and was suspended from May 18 to June 14 and can play again on June 15. He is also liable for costs of £250.

The case was heard by an RFU panel of His Honour Judge Jeff Blackett, Peter Budge and Jeff Probyn at the London Bloomsbury Holiday Inn.
